محول الثنائي إلى نص
Mode
Select encode or decode mode
Options
Add "0b" before each binary byte
Text Input
Binary Output
أدوات ذات صلة
ما هو النظام الثنائي؟
النظام الثنائي هو أبسط نظام ترقيم تستخدمه الحواسيب. يستخدم رقمين فقط: 0 و 1. تُجمع هذه الأرقام، المسماة بتات، لتمثيل جميع أنواع البيانات في الأنظمة الرقمية، بما في ذلك النصوص والصور والبرامج.
تحول هذه الأداة المجانية عبر الإنترنت النص إلى تمثيله الثنائي (التشفير) أو تحول الثنائي إلى نص قابل للقراءة (فك التشفير). تدعم تنسيقات متعددة بما في ذلك البايتات المفصولة بمسافات والسلاسل الثنائية المتصلة والمزيد.
تتم جميع المعالجة مباشرة في متصفحك - بياناتك لا تغادر جهازك أبداً.
كيف يعمل التشفير الثنائي
رموز الأحرف
كل حرف له رمز رقمي (مثل ASCII أو Unicode). على سبيل المثال، 'A' هو 65، 'B' هو 66، وهكذا. ثم تُحول هذه الأرقام إلى ثنائي.
بايتات 8-بت
يستخدم التشفير القياسي 8 بتات لكل حرف (بايت). يمكن لكل بايت تمثيل قيم من 0 إلى 255، مما يغطي جميع أحرف ASCII والمزيد.
قراءة الثنائي
يُقرأ الثنائي من اليمين إلى اليسار، حيث يمثل كل موضع قوة من 2. على سبيل المثال، 01000001 = 64+1 = 65 = 'A'.
دعم UTF-8
تدعم هذه الأداة ترميز UTF-8، مما يعني أنها يمكنها التعامل مع الأحرف من أي لغة، بما في ذلك الرموز التعبيرية والرموز الخاصة.
الأسئلة الشائعة
ما الفرق بين 8-بت و 7-بت؟
يستخدم 8-بت (القياسي) 8 أرقام ثنائية لكل حرف، ويدعم القيم من 0 إلى 255. أما 7-بت فهو لـ ASCII الأصلي الذي يستخدم فقط القيم من 0 إلى 127. معظم التطبيقات الحديثة تستخدم ترميز 8-بت.
لماذا تُنتج بعض الأحرف بايتات متعددة؟
UTF-8 هو ترميز متغير الطول. تستخدم أحرف ASCII الأساسية بايت واحد، لكن الأحرف من لغات أخرى أو الرموز التعبيرية قد تستخدم 2 أو 3 أو حتى 4 بايتات لتمثيل قيم Unicode الكاملة.
هل يمكنني استخدام فواصل مختلفة؟
نعم! عند التشفير، يمكنك الاختيار بين المسافات أو الفواصل أو الأسطر الجديدة أو بدون فاصل. عند فك التشفير، تكتشف الأداة تلقائياً الفواصل الشائعة بما في ذلك المسافات والفواصل والشرطات.
هل تُرسل بياناتي إلى خادم؟
لا. يتم كل التحويل بالكامل في متصفحك باستخدام JavaScript. بياناتك لا تغادر جهازك أبداً، مما يجعل هذه الأداة خاصة وآمنة تماماً.